Tokyo

Tokyo - a diamond of a city: a multi-faceted, sparkling metropolis which is rock-hard when it comes to business. And difficult to take in…

There is virtually nowhere else in the world which is so full of contrasts and (apparent?) contradictions. The massive metropolis has around 14 million inhabitants. But where are they all? The answer soon becomes clear in the rush hour, when the doors of the underground trains and trams will not close and the roads and urban motorways are hopelessly clogged up, or on the weekends, when Disneyland and the other amusement parks are amass with people.

But Tokyo also has a more serene side, with extensive gardens, avenues of cherry trees, Buddhist temples and Shinto shrines set amidst the skyscrapers, all places of tranquillity and contemplation. And what museums! Not only does the city have huge world-famous collections, it also has charming little exhibitions, such as the museums of swords, kimonos, sake, or bonsai, where you can find out a great deal about the culture of everyday life in Japan.
